The following feature of cu 7 dy 2 must be examined also: this phase forms from l and cu 9 dy 2 by a peritectic reaction at 935 °c and decomposes into the original phases on cooling by a catatectic reaction at 854 °c. this feature requires extremely delicate balance in the thermodynamic properties of the phases involved.

Because the experimental data were scarce, the phase diagram was constructed by thermodynamic modeling based on assumed similarity of this system to cu gd, cu dy, and cu er systems. the phase diagram of [1988sub] was revised by [2009wan] by taking into account new literature data on the thermodynamic properties. The cu–dy binary system has been thermodynamically assessed with calphad approach. the solution phases including liquid, bcc, fcc and hcp were treated as substitutional solution phases, of which the excess gibbs energies were formulated with redlich–kister polynomial functions. the binary intermetallic compounds were treated as.
